Try juicing with a masticating type of juicer. These juicers gently extract juice which helps retain many nutrients in the liquid. The juice obtained this way will last longer in storage.

Add cucumber to dark leafy greens for improved flavor.Many of the leafy greens don’t taste very good.Cucumber can mask the unpleasant taste and also add a refreshing flavor of its own.

When juicing for the health benefits, your best options when it comes to ingredients are greens that include broccoli, chard, kale, kale and spinach for the greatest effectiveness. The healthiest juice consists of fifty to seventy percent greens, you want to then add some fruit or tastier vegetables for some flavor. Juices made exclusively from fruit often have more unhealthy sugar than greens-based juices.

Plan your juices by color. The full color spectrum of fresh fruits and vegetables, from reds to greens to oranges, is an indication the variety of nutrients that are available. These differences make for a broader flavor range to choose from and provide you with proper nutrition.

Juicing for the fridge is a great idea, however, you will want to prevent color change in the juice. Understandably, brown or grey colored juice isn’t appetizing to most people. You can prevent discoloration by mixing in a few teaspoonfuls of freshly squeezed lemon juice. Lemon juice has the ability to keep the juice fresh without affecting its taste.
